You are the new Manager of Online Sales for Duckworthy Rain Gear (DRG), a company that sells waterproof apparel to outdoor enthusiasts and people who must work in inclement weather. As you review the online payment processing system, you notice that DRG does not ask its customers to provide a CVN (also known as a CVV, CVV2, CSC, and so on) when they enter their credit card information on the shopping cart page of the Web site. Your prior employer always collected CVNs because they reduced the chances that a card payment transaction was fraudulent. You ask Sally Montt, the lead Web programmer, why the company is not collecting CVNs. She tells you that your predecessor established a policy of not collecting them because he said that storing those numbers is prohibited. Using the Web Links for this exercise, your favorite search engine, or your library, evaluate the accuracy of your predecessors statement. If storing CVNs is prohibited, determine who is responsible for the prohibition. Summarize your findings in a memo to the President of DRG in which you make a recommendation for collecting or not collecting CVNs.

Bonnie Carson has owned and managed her gift and card shop in the Central Shopping Mall for three years. She has a merchant account with her local bank to process payment card charges at her shop in the mall. Business at the mall store had been good, but Bonnie wanted to expand without paying higher rent for more floor space at the mall. A year ago, she opened an online store using a commerce service provider. Part of the monthly fee that the CSP charges covers the software needed to accept credit cards online. The CSP handles the payment processing, but the charges are much higher than those her bank charges to process the transactions for her shop in the mall. Bonnies online business is beginning to pick up and she wants to provide more payment options to her customers and is considering a payment processing service such as PayPal or Checkout by Amazon as an additional option. Identify at least three reasons Bonnie should use such a service and at least three reasons she should not. Prepare a report for Bonnie of about 200 words summarizing your findings.
